Your Normal Experience
You'll spend your residency embedded with the team building and characterizing our unconventional, thermodynamic computing hardware — silicon that exploits physical noise and analog dynamics rather than fighting them.
This is a hands-on research residency: you'll take ownership of a real technical problem at the boundary of physics, hardware, and machine learning, work alongside the researchers and engineers building our hardware, and be expected to contribute ideas, not just execute someone else's.
Our hardware is designed to deliver orders-of-magnitude more AI inference per dollar, per watt than conventional GPUs — not by porting existing GPU kernels onto new chips, but by rethinking how core operations work when the substrate itself is stochastic analog computation in memory rather than conventional digital logic. That rethinking, from device physics up through algorithms, is exactly the kind of problem residents take on.
You'll get direct exposure to the pace, ambiguity, and speed of decision-making that comes with working at a fast-moving, well-funded hardware startup — where the distance between an idea on a whiteboard and a test on real silicon is measured in weeks, not years.
What You'll Do
Work hands-on with thermodynamic hardware. Help design, simulate, characterize, or evaluate our hardware, where noise, analog dynamics, and in-memory computation are first-class design elements rather than sources of error to be engineered away.
Design numerical methods for a new substrate. Explore algorithms and numerical methods that exploit thermal noise and analog dynamics directly, rather than adapting techniques built for conventional digital hardware.
Drive a research question of your own. Partner with researchers and hardware engineers to scope, run, and iterate on an original technical investigation — from device- or circuit-level physics up to algorithms and workloads that map onto thermodynamic compute.
Build evaluation frameworks and benchmarks. Help build the tests and benchmarks that measure how algorithmic ideas actually perform on real hardware and in simulation, and feed what you learn about model workloads back into hardware design decisions.
Co-author a paper. Work with the team to write up your findings for submission to a relevant venue, with mentorship on framing, experiments, and technical writing along the way — one of the two milestones every resident builds toward.
Present at the residency colloquium. Share your work and thinking with the broader Normal Computing research community at the program's capstone event, and get real-time feedback from people building this technology every day.
